
立即学习“go语言免费学习笔记(深入)”; 示例:检查字符串是否包含数字 matched := re.MatchString("abc123")<br> fmt.Println(matched) // 输出 true 查找匹配内容 常用方法包括: 行者AI 行者AI绘图创作,唤醒新的灵感...

有没有更灵活的办法? 类属性 (Class Attributes): 如果你想让所有Person对象都共享一个值,比如所有人都来自“地球”,或者有一个共同的计数器,那就可以用类属性。 核心思想: 初始化一个全零的稠密矩阵,然后使用NumPy的高级索引功能,根据 row 和 col 数组将 value...

这可能会导致一些困惑,尤其是在需要尽快启动多个协程并稍后等待它们完成的情况下。 这其实是充分利用了两种模式的优势。 手动实现序列化与反序列化 最基础的方式是通过重载输入输出操作符或编写自定义函数来实现序列化逻辑。 基本上就这些。 这两种接收者类型决定了方法如何访问和修改结构体实例。 判断单个数是否为...

使用指针替代大对象字段,可以减小结构体体积,尤其是在频繁复制或构建切片时效果明显。 适合用于验证码、水印图等场景。 核心思想是通过状态转移方程避免重复计算,提升效率。 归档完整性: 这种方法依赖于tar归档的特定结构。 动态模块加载的最佳实践是什么? 只要连接驱动支持、连接参数明确设置、数据库字段类...

保持注释简洁准确,与代码同步更新,是维护高质量Go项目的关键习惯。 通过组合使用`unpivot`、`list.to_struct`和`unnest`等核心操作,教程演示了如何将宽格式的列表列转换为长格式,并动态地将列表元素扩展为独立的数值列,从而实现复杂的数据结构转换,提升数据处理的灵活性和效率。...

np.flatnonzero()函数返回的是数组中非零元素的索引。 在处理日期数据时,请务必仔细检查日期格式,并确保 format 字符串与实际的日期格式完全匹配。 无涯·问知 无涯·问知,是一款基于星环大模型底座,结合个人知识库、企业知识库、法律法规、财经等多种知识源的企业级垂直领域问答产品 40...

根据实际需求选择合适的方式:channel适合控制并发数,rate.Limiter适合精确控制速率,自定义方案则灵活但需注意性能和正确性。 核心原则是在编译开销与运行时收益之间找到平衡点。 在PHP中保存图片,理解不同图片格式的特性并选择合适的保存函数至关重要,这直接影响到图片质量、文件大小以及是否...

建议根据接口平均响应时间设置合理阈值。 • ofstream:继承自 ostream,专门用于向文件写入数据。 C.GoString用于C char*到Go string。 以下是具体操作方法: 1. 找到并编辑 php.ini 文件 一键PHP环境通常自带管理面板,可通过以下方式进入: 打开环境管...

我们遍历这个切片,对每个元素,递归调用processDynamicJSON来处理。 写好测试中的错误处理,不只是让测试通过,更是为了将来重构时提供信心。 在C++中解析一个简单的JSON字符串,最常用的方法是使用第三方库。 核心思路是:主程序在运行时通过反射识别并调用外部模块中的函数或类型,而不需要...

<?php namespace App\Controllers; use CodeIgniter\Controller; // 不需要直接 use App\Libraries\ExampleLibrary; class MyController extends Controller { pro...